Summary
Fishery worker who uses bottom trawls to catch large quantities of fish and shellfish near the seabed.
Description
Bottom trawl fishermen equip fishing boats with large nets (trawl nets) and perform intensive trawling near the seabed to catch fish species. They use fish finders, currents, and weather observations to select optimal fishing grounds, and carry out net deployment and retrieval, hauling operations, sorting and selecting catches, and on-board preliminary processing and preservation as a team. Long sea duty, heavy labor, adaptation to changing sea conditions, and coordination with fishery cooperatives and buyers are essential.
Future Outlook
Due to declining birthrates, aging population, and decreasing fishery resources, the number of workers is on a downward trend. Improvements in efficiency, ICT utilization, and the introduction of sustainable fishery management are required.
